AgriProFocus is hosted by SNV Netherlands Development Organisation in Zambia and supported by the AgriProFocus Netherlands secretariat. Its responsibility is to create opportunities for Agribusiness multi–stakeholder action and to facilitate connections and business links between professionals and organizations through business platforms, learning and networking events, market research and publications.
AgriProFocus (www.agriprofocus.com/zambia) is a partnership which aims to promote agri-entrepeneurship in developing countries to improve food and nutrition security. The partnership originated in the Netherlands and has 13 country networks in Africa and Asia. The network in Zambia is a multi-stakeholder network which serves as a neutral marketplace for professionals from agri-businesses, producer organizations, NGOs, government, research institutions to share expertise and do business.
